Abstract

PURPOSE: To feed oxygen needful for the cell from ventilation openings by stretching a water repellent air permeable microporous membrane on ventilation openings provided on walls of the cell chamber.
CONSTITUTION: Several ventilation openings 2 are provided on the side faces of a container 1, a membrane 3 and on both sides of the membrane two reinforcing wire nets 4 of 0.4mm mesh of. e.g., stainless steel, are stretched on the ventilation openings 2. A thin tetrafluoroethylene film of thinner than 100μ is used as the membrane 3, and many micropores 5 of smaller than 10μ for permeation of air are provided on the membrane. Thus when the cell container is soaked in sea water and the openings 2 are soaked, the water tight of the container is kept complete, and air can permeate into the cell container through the membrane 3 to feed oxygen to the air cell.
